SHARE
Параметр share - самый нужный, так как только с его помощью можно распределить ресурсы рабочей станции Microsoft Workgroup Add-On for MS-DOS в коллективное пользование.
Полный формат параметра для распределения дисков представлен ниже:
net share ShareName=Drive:[Path][/remark:"Text"][/saveshare:no] [/read[:Pwd1]][/full[:Pwd2]]
Здесь ShareName - сетевое имя, которое будет видно пользователям других рабочих станций. Точнее говоря, пользователи сети будут видеть ваш диск или каталог как сетевой ресурс с именем ShareName.
С помощью параметров Drive и Path вы можете определить, соответственно, диск и каталог, отдаваемый в коллективное пользование. Как мы уже говорили, каталог можно не указывать. В этом случае пользователям будет доступен корневой каталог диска.
Дополнительно при распределении диска или каталога вы можете указать параметры /remark, /saveshare:no, /read и /full.
Параметр /remark позволяет задать произвольный текстовый комментарий Text, описывающий ресурс. Этот комментарий будет отображаться в списке сетевых ресурсов рабочей станции.
Если указать параметр /saveshare:no, каждый раз при запуске рабочей станции вам придется заново отдавать ее ресурсы в коллективное пользование запуском программы net.exe с параметром share. По умолчанию установлен такой режим, при котором вам достаточно распределить ресурс только один раз. После этого он будет автоматически распределяться каждый раз при запуске сетевой компоненты Microsoft Workgroup Add-On for MS-DOS.
Вы можете ограничить доступ пользователей к дискам вашей рабочей станции, указав при распределении параметры /read и /full с паролем или без пароля.
По умолчанию предоставляется доступ только на чтение (которому соответствует параметр /read), причем без пароля. Для предоставления полного доступа к диску или каталогу вы должны указать параметр /full (с паролем или без).
Например, следующая команда предоставляет полный доступ к каталогу d:\src только после предъявления пароля:
net share source=d:\src /remark:"Source Code Lib" /full:pwdfull
С помощью параметра share вы можете распределить в коллективное пользование любой локальный параллельный принтерный порт компьютера. Формат параметра аналогичен приведенному выше, но вместо диска и пути необходимо указать имя порта: lpt1, lpt2 и т. д.
Например:
net share laserjet=lpt2: /remark:"Printer LaserJet III"
Не менее важная функция параметра share - изменение характеристик доступа пользователей к ресурсу (вид доступа и пароль), а также полная отмена распределения ресурса в коллективное пользование.
Приведем соответствующий формат параметра share:
net share ShareName [/remark:"Text"][/delete] [/read[:Pwd1]][/full[:Pwd2]]
Например, следующая команда отменяет распределение в коллективное пользование для принтера laserjet:
net share laserjet /delete
Если выдать команду "net share" без дополнительных параметров, на экране появится список ресурсов рабочей станции, распределенных в коллективное пользование, с указанием типа ресурса и комментария (если он есть):
Shared resources at \\FROLOV Sharename Type Comment -------------------------------------------------------------- PRT Print WINDOWSDIR Disk The command completed successfully.